Description

Quantum Tiny Linux Development Kit is one of the smallest development boards available on the market, designed to work with Linux. It consists of the SoM (System on Module) Quark-N and the Atom-N expansion board.

Quark-N is a SoM module based on the Allwinner H3 quad-core processor with Cortex-A7 core and Mali400 MP2 GPU. Has a built-in RAM 512 MB and 16 GB eMMC memory. The six-layer gold-plated PCB integrates the full ARM-Linux system (CPU, DDR, eMMC) in a space of 20 x 30 mm. Most of the GPIOs are derived from the M.2 Key-A interface connector. Thanks to this, the user can easily design a base plate dedicated to his own project.

Atom-N is an expansion board for Quark-N that connects to the SoM via the M.2 interface. It is equipped with a set of gold-plated pins on which interfaces such as SPI, I2C, UART and GPIO have been led out. In addition, the board has a microphone, MPU6050 motion sensor (accelerometer and gyroscope), 4 buttons (GPIO-KEY, Uboot, Recovery, Reset), IPS display, Wi-Fi and Bluetooth connectivity.

Such large possibilities with the small size of the board make the set perfect for various applications, such as a personal server, intelligent voice assistant or a robot control system. Full documentation with sample programs is available on the product page.

Features

Quark-N SoM

  • Allwinner H3 Cortex-A7 @ 1GHz quad-core processor
  • GPU ARM Mali400 MP2
  • 512 MB LPDDR3 RAM memory
  • 16 GB eMMC memory
  • Interfaces: Ethernet, SPI, I2C, UART, GPIO, MIC, LINEOUT
  • 26 pin connector, with USB OTG, USB-Serial, I2C, UART, SPI, I2S, GPIO
  • Working temperature: 0 to 80°C
  • Dimensions: 31 x 22 mm

Atom-N Carrier Board

  • M.2 slot for Quark-N
  • 2 x USB 2.0
  • USB Type-C
  • RTL8723BU wireless connectivity:
  • Wi-Fi: IEEE 802.11 b/g/n 2.4 GHz
  • Bluetooth: BT V2.1 / BT V3.0 / BT V4.0
  • Built-in peripherals
  • Microphone
  • MPU6050 motion sensor (gyroscope + accelerometer)
  • 4 x buttons (GPIO-KEY, Uboot, Recovery, Reset)
  • TFT display
  • MicroSD card slot
  • Dimensions: 40 x 35 mm

Kit contains

  • SoM Quark-N module
  • Atom-N expansion board
